[ QUOTE ]
Thanks for the replies. What mistake did I make on the flop with top pair though? Should I have just bet at it? There were 6 SB in the pot, if I bet I'm offering 6.5:1 on a call. Check-raising was the better play in my view, and so was waiting for the turn, where my bet offered 4:1 (not 3:1 right because my bet added to the 3 already in there would make it 4:1). Yeah, I should be thankful for calling stations, but I was just a little frustrated tonight. I should try to pay more attention to my opponents tendencies as well. I haven't read TOP, but maybe I'll pick it up. Thanks again.

[/ QUOTE ]

Having the flop checked around is among THE WORST things that you could have let happen. You let it happen. Since you CANNOT BE *SURE* of someone else betting (you preflop raised...they might be scared) you *MUST* bet. "IF i bet I'm offereing 6:1 on a call" That's correct! But if you check, you offer them 6:0!!! That's WORSE!

Waiting for the turn is also very bad. If they have a single A of trump (the flush suit), you check the flop, it gets checked around. Now another trump suit shows up on the board. Your opponent with A of trump has picked up a 9 out draw! FOR FREE! You have to bet, and let them make a mistake by calling you. When you check, they are making no mistakes

YOU ARE.
